当TP钱包出现签名错误时,既可能是客户端签名流程问题,也可能是链上验证、密钥管理或云服https://www.lnyzm.com ,务配置导致。本文以技术指南风格,给出深入可执行的排查与修复流程,并从高级加密、弹性云、安全响应、支付系统与信息化创新角度做出市场未来预测。
1) 初始取证:收集原始交易数据(rawTx)、签名字段(r,s,v)、消息哈希、chainId与nonce,记录客户端版本、SDK与硬件钱包型号,导出日志并入SIEM,确保时间同步与证据链完整。
2) 本地重放验证:在隔离环境重建签名摘要(EIP-191/EIP-712),用secp256k1库做ecrecover比对公钥,确认是签名生成错误、序列化偏差还是链上验证规则不同导致的问题。

3) 密钥与加密技术排查:检查KMS/HSM、Secure Enclave或MPC阈值签名服务是否异常,验证随机数质量与nonce来源,必要时引入阈值签名或Schnorr以强化抗攻击能力与签名聚合性能。
4) 弹性云部署与运维:利用容器编排与自动扩容在高并发下运行批量重放与一致性检查,确保密钥访问通过云HSM或私有KMS受控,日志持久化并纳入可搜索审计库。
5) 安全响应流程:触发IR runbook——隔离受影响实例、撤换/吊销相关API与会话凭证、对可疑交易进行链上监控并通知交易所/用户,完成补丁、回滚、并在灰度环境验证后恢复服务。
6) 支付系统与信息化创新:设计端到端幂等与重试策略防止双花,采用链下签名聚合与零知识证明降低链上负载,结合可审计的多方计算保护密钥全生命周期。
7) 市场未来预测:未来两年MPC与云HSM服务将常态化,零知识与抗量子算法将逐步融入支付系统,监管驱动下合规化钱包设计与独立第三方审计成为标配。

推荐执行流程:取证→本地验证→密钥态势评估→补丁与回滚→持续监控与事后演练。遵循以上步骤,可以在兼顾可用性的同时最大限度降低资产与声誉风险,形成闭环防护与可复现的应急能力。
评论
tech_girl
内容很实用,重放验证和HSM部分对我帮助很大。
王工程师
建议补充对MPC工具链的具体推荐。
CryptoFan
关于EIP-712的重建示例能否提供脚本?
李诚
安全响应流程清晰,已纳入团队演练。
Nova88
市场预测观点新颖,认同零知识应用前景。